Questions & Answers

What companies run services between Cittadella, Veneto, Italy and Pisa, Italy?

You can take a train from Cittadella to Pisa Centrale via Padova and Firenze S.M.N. in around 4h 18m. Alternatively, Ryanair and Ulendo Airlink fly from Venice Marco Polo Airport (VCE) to Pisa International Airport (PSA) twice daily.
